How soon will waiting days get fully spent,
Before Eternity expires as reached,
Before from sadness, hearts are fully rent,
Before Time's utmost boundaries are breached;
I'll wait until forever and a day,
And watch for signs that hint of your return,
In oracle, prayer, and augury,
In altar, high, my offerings will burn;
But time unravels slow, though without cease,
And moments move along with joys and pains,
And Life, in length, will never so increase,
Beyond the limit that the living gains;
...Return you must, before it turns too late,
...Before Time ends, but more, to end the wait.
